Transaction 250872789824fdd6a185c87f8742455f40f0cd0cda5efaca57580d40b8ccad52
1 Input
1 Output
-
250872789824fdd6a185c87f8742455f40f0cd0cda5efaca57580d40b8ccad52:0
- value
- 521019
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4bd0b2f80df164c0216a9d16bbc40693a6b343d7 OP_EQUAL
- address
- 38btcbfko61AGQEzrdv1pzVk4bjwRL5huD